what do F heads look like
In addition to the large letter there's a casting number specific to the heads. Above the center exhaust port, near the valve cover, on both sides of the head bolt are the numbers. For the E it would be 403 686 Then for the F it would be 404 438 Those numbers cannot be faked. John

Do you have a 1970 W30 car? If you watch ebay and the Oldsmobile sites the D and F heads come up a few times a year. I think the H heads are more like one set every few years. Expect to pay $3,000-4000 for a set though so unless you've got the correct car needing those heads it probably isn't worth spending that kind of money. Other heads could be made to flow better for much less. My 2 cents. John
